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Trehafod to Battlesbridge start from as little as £29.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Trehafod to Battlesbridge start from £108.40 one way, or £109.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Trehafod to Battlesbridge are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Trehafod Station

Trehafod Station is equipped with several useful facilities to make your journey as smooth as possible. While there is no ticket office, fear not! 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online with ease. For those with hearing impairments, induction loops are installed, and accessible ticket machines are on offer for ease of use. While the station doesn’t feature a waiting room or refreshments, there is a seating area for passengers to rest before catching their train. CCTV is in operation for added security, ensuring you feel safe at all times.

Accessibility and Support

Trehafod is committed to providing an accessible travel experience, though it does present some limitations. The station is classified as Category B3, indicating step-free access is partially available. Access to Platform 1, which serves Treherbert, requires navigating a subway and steps. Similarly, reaching Platform 2 towards Pontypridd involves using the subway and steps, though there is a footpath with a steep gradient furnishing access from Bridge Street. For those requiring assistance, a helpline is available and customers can book the Passenger Assist service up to two hours before their journey.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Battlesbridge train station may not boast a ticket office, but it does feature ticket machines that are equipped for online ticket collection and accept smartcard validations. Perfect for independent travelers, the station provides crucial accessibility facilities including step-free access across its single platform, making it compliant with the Office of Rail and Road's classification as a Category A station. There is a ramp for train access and seating available on-site, enhancing the ease of navigation for all passengers. However, amenities such as wa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ities are not available – a common feature of smaller stations.
